News

With most of its U.S.-based staff laid off, some RFA employees who report from the safety of Washington. D.C., now risk losing not only their jobs but also their work visas and could face deportation ...
Since Donald Trump said he wanted to make Canada the 51st American state, Quebec has openly shown support for the country it ...